Zachary Daniels Recruitment is seeking a part-time Supervisor for their Salford store. This role involves leading by example to maintain exceptional customer service standards and achieving store KPIs.
The position offers 22.5 hours of work per week with flexibility from Monday to Saturday.
The ideal candidate should have experience in retail or service environments and be proactive in driving team productivity.

How to prepare for a job interview at Zachary Daniels Recruitment
✨Know Your Customer Service Standards
Before the interview, brush up on what exceptional customer service looks like. Be ready to share examples from your past experiences where you went above and beyond for customers. This will show that you understand the importance of maintaining high standards.
✨Demonstrate Leadership Skills
As a part-time Supervisor, you'll need to lead by example. Think of specific instances where you've motivated a team or resolved conflicts. Highlight these during your interview to showcase your proactive approach to driving team productivity.
✨Familiarise Yourself with KPIs
Research common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) in retail. Be prepared to discuss how you’ve met or exceeded KPIs in previous roles. This will demonstrate your understanding of the business side of retail and your commitment to achieving store goals.
✨Flexibility is Key
Since the role offers flexible hours, be ready to discuss your availability. Show that you’re adaptable and willing to work different shifts. This will reassure them that you can meet the demands of the position while maintaining a great customer experience.
